Do solar panels work if it snows?

Snowy winter often means less solar energy production, but with effective solar panel snow removal, you can maintain good efficiency. Did you know that even during cold months, solar panels can still generate about 50 to 80 percent of their maximum output? How can you ensure they perform at their best? Removing snow is key.

Why do solar panels need snow removal?

Regular snow removal ensures consistent energy generation and maximizes the financial benefits of your solar panel system. Snow accumulation on solar panels can not only hinder their performance and efficiency but also causes potential safety hazards.

Can solar panels withstand heavy snow?

Don’t Ignore Heavy Snow: Do not let heavy snow accumulate on your solar panels for too long, as it can significantly reduce efficiency and potentially cause damage. Your solar panels rely on photovoltaic (PV) cells, located in the front layers, to capture sunlight and convert it into electricity.

Should solar panels be covered in snow?

Maximizing Energy Output: When solar panels are covered in snow, they generate less electricity or even stop producing power altogether. Clearing the snow allows the panels to capture sunlight and convert it into electricity, maximizing energy output. This ensures you can make the most of your solar investment and reap the financial benefits.
